AI

Revolutionizing Game Art with AI: Enhancing Asset Creation & Outsourcing

Guillaume Chichmanov
|
February 18, 2024

We are living in an era where two different but overlapping industries are progressing rapidly: one is the gaming industry, which has hit 347 billion USD, and the second is the AI art industry, which currently scores 403 million USD in annual revenues. It won't be a stretch to say that Artificial Intelligence has the potential to revolutionize gaming with improved machine translation, unlimited player customizations, infinite scenarios, and a bigger supply of designs than ever. 

As studios try to push frontiers, game art can be a massive catalyst for creating lifelike environments and realistic gameplay mechanisms. However, the full potential of AI gaming art is yet to be tapped in Metaverse and other platforms. This guide will discuss the roles it is currently playing and could play in the future for the gaming industry. 

How will AI advancements improve gaming designs and interactive landscapes in future games? Should you hire game artists for 3D art creation? These and many other questions will be answered below, so keep reading. 

Rendering Improvements 

The first thing that people notice while playing video games is their graphics. Although they have come a long way, AI can take them one step ahead by providing graphics with unprecedented clarity. Since modern AI relies heavily on machine learning and neural networks, game art outsourcing studios can now use features like deep learning super-sampling (DLSS) to improve images and ensure high-level performance.

Another technique called real-time ray tracing has significantly improved lighting and shadows, providing an immersive gaming environment. However, these techniques have not just made new games better; they can also be used to upscale older titles by uplifting their visuals and giving them modern aesthetics. 

Moreover, these advancements aren't just about visual improvements. They are also excellent for rationalizing computational resources. AI can determine which part of the scene needs more resources, thus allocating them efficiently, which might not be as accurate otherwise.

Character Animations 

Characters are another critical part of any game, which is why character animations and rigging are integral components of AI-based game development. Instead of using frame-by-frame animations, AI can develop animations that adapt according to the changing environment and generate complex movements. By integrating dynamic facial expressions with it, AI produces more refined and detailed gaming performance. 

Let's explore four major aspects of AI character animations: 

1. Facial Expressions 

AI has proven to be extremely useful when it comes to featuring nuanced and realistic facial expressions. With that, it improves both the NPC and player experience. Here are some of the highlights of AI in facial expressions:

  • AI-enabled NPCs develop expressions according to different contexts. Therefore, they can provide a more realistic gaming environment. 
  • These characters can design new facial expressions on the go, adapting to different situations instantly. Hence, they bring more dynamism to the gameplay. 
  • AI rigging allows for better muscle movements in different facial expressions, making characters more realistic.

2. Procedural Animation Techniques 

AI helps developers create lifelike movements without relying on manual keyframing. Instead, it uses algorithms that help characters adapt to changing environments and interact with them accordingly. AI-developed characters understand the complexities of the world and have complex physical responses.

3. Dynamic Motion Capture Integration 

Dynamic Motion Capture Integration deals with translating human movements in the real world to an in-game environment. It uses advanced machine learning and algorithms to predict movements, ensuring a more realistic character representation. In this area, Adversarial Networks (GANs) are the latest developments that take gaming personalization to the next level.

4. Creative Clothing Designs 

Clothing is also an integral element that enhances facial expressions to make a well-rounded character. Sophisticated AI algorithms can create a vast array of clothing options that vary in style, color, era, fitting different scenarios and player preferences. By leveraging the relevant AI tools, developers can fill their games with a rich collection of apparel and make them more appealing.  

Texture Enhancements 

AI has also significantly improved texture-creation for characters and environments. Developers can now use Generative AI that understands the complexity of real-world systems and generates the same in the gaming environment. Here's how Generative AI becomes useful in texture enhancements:

  • Analyzing large amounts of data to understand patterns and replicating them. 
  • Reducing development time by rapidly generating newer and better textures. It allows developers to focus on other things while AI handles the repetitive tasks. 
  • Continuous learning allows AI systems to harness more data as it comes in to improve texture creation.

Realistic Lighting & Shading 

It's not only texture that makes a gaming environment lifelike; one also needs to develop realistic lighting and its respective shadows to truly engage players. Thankfully, AI systems are capable enough to create dynamic lighting and shadows to enhance player experiences and make games more realistic. It does that by using sophisticated algorithms that automatically calculate the lighting conditions and their resulting shadows. 

These systems don't just develop static light but how light develops and behaves in the real world. Therefore, players experience a realistic shift in lighting and shadows while playing games. It also allows developers to build games with more depth and realism, which was previously very tricky. 

As a result, studios can develop games that depict light as it behaves during any time of the day or night without doing anything manually.

Environmental Design 

AI also enhances the gameplay experience by developing intricate landscapes that resemble real-life environments. Using advanced machine learning, AI uses the elements within a game to generate aesthetically pleasing environments that take the gaming experience to the next level. Here is how AI impacts environmental design in games:

  • Developing unpredictable terrains with Procedural Content Generation (PCG).
  • Creating new AI game assets by analyzing already available content and seamlessly blending the old and the new. 
  • Generating novel gameplay scenarios by curating personal quests and challenges.

Let's explore environmental design with AI a bit more and understand its various aspects.

1. Weather Simulations 

AI-enabled gaming environments also possess advanced weather simulations that can change rapidly. These weather conditions resemble the real world with rain, dust storms, snow, blizzards, and whatnot. 

With these weather intricacies, the game's atmosphere evolves with changing landscapes. Moreover, changing weather patterns introduce an element of unpredictability with pleasing aesthetics.  

2. Ecological Interactions 

Advancements in AI also allow game developers to introduce complex ecological interactions, making their games more realistic. These are organic interactions that players might experience in the real world, making the games more fun and elevating the overall experience. Some of the most popular ecological interactions in the games are:

  • Survival behaviors where predators and prey battle it out in an elaborate food chain. 
  • Natural plant growth and decay life cycles that mimic real-life conditions. 
  • Natural disasters and unpredictable weather patterns. 

Helpful Tools & Techniques

Creativity is the bedrock of success in the gaming industry. With hundreds of AI tools available to provide creative assistance, one must choose the best to stay ahead of the competition. Let's look at some of the best tools developers can use to develop creative and engaging games.

1. Unity 

The Unity Engine allows developers to turn their ideas into reality on any platform, from mobile to console. It can create everything from 2-D pixel art to elaborate 3-D graphics, depending upon one's vision. Unity has also incorporated the latest AI tools, such as the Unity Muse and Unity Sentis, that are transforming the gaming landscape.

1.a. Unity Muse 

Unity Muse turns your ideas into a gaming reality with natural language prompts. These tasks took hours and hours of work but can now be translated to a gaming environment in no time. Instead of spending time on the setup, developers can invest that time in things that matter more.  

1.b. Unity Sentis

Unity Sentis is a model built on the ONNX file standard to create new gameplay experiences. It allows developers to implement standard AI models, such as speech recognition. Moreover, Sentis uses the power of end-user devices instead of relying on a complex Cloud infrastructure.

2. Get3D by Nvidia 

Trained using 2D images, this generative AI has come a long way and can now generate complex 3D graphics from a building to a vehicle. With intricate geometric details and common formats, they can be transferred immediately. 

The details that can take a team several hours or days can be generated within minutes with Get3D. For instance, it can help developers generate large crowds or non-repetitive vehicles.

3. Scenario 

Scenario brings powerful AI tools that work equally well on all platforms. Developers can generate AI game assets using their advanced gaming engine that functions on mobile, too. So, you can create and preview your game designs on the go with text prompts and referential images. 

Scenario’s in-game API lets you leverage custom-trained AI models that also feature image creation, editing, and support for Ruby, PHP, Node, and many more. You can also connect it to the Unity Editor using a special plugin to bring all the Scenario's features to Unity.

4. AssetsAI 

AssetsAI is another powerful tool that helps developers generate their favorite styles and designs. It already has excellent assets that users can own forever after buying, with the platform adding new assets every week. From helmets to treasure chests, there is nothing that you cannot create with this AI tool.

5. TrainEngine 

TrainEngine works on a generative AI model that can create as many images and assets as you want across multiple categories. Thanks to its training based on a diverse dataset, you can use it to create icons, characters, 3D models, and whatnot.

Outsource Asset Creation to Cominted Labs 

Asset creation for games can be a hectic process, but it doesn't have to be. With Cominted Labs, you have an extensive team of experts who create 3D assets at unprecedented speeds. You just need to submit a request, and we'll develop the required 3D models and animations. While we are developing them, you can keep track of them and communicate directly with the project manager.

Cominted Labs has created a world-class 3D art assistant in Chat GPT with more than 1,000 tools plugged in, making us one of the largest game art outsourcing studios. Our extensive portfolio speaks volumes about our credibility and experience in 3D game art generation. We bring you the fastest development and delivery time with predictable and affordable pricing. So, contact us today and outsource your 3D game art creation to a reliable industry player.

Share this article

Related Articles